James Webb Space Telescope Discovers Uranus’ 29th Moon

Astronomers using the James Webb Space Telescope (JWST) have discovered a tiny new moon orbiting Uranus, increasing the planet’s moon count to 29. Germany Arrests Ukrainian National in Nord Stream Pipeline Sabotage Case

Germany has arrested a Ukrainian national, identified as Serhii K., who is believed to have coordinated the 2022 undersea bombing of two gas pipelines that linked Russia to Germany.
